//Penomoran Otomatis utk pemograman penjualan barang
If ttrans.eof then
edit1.text = "NT001"
else begin
ttrans.last;
notrans.ttransnotrans.value; //NT001
notrans := copy (faktur 3,3) ; //002
no:= strtoint(notrans);
no:= no +1;
nofaktur:= copy(nottrans, length(notrans) -2 , 3);
notrans;= NT + notrans; //NT002
edit1.text := notrans;
ttrans.first;
end;
edit2.setfocus;
NB: Listing diatas untuk program Delphi so yg gak pake delphi maaf yaa....!
ttrans (nama tabel database)
notrans (nama field nomor transaksi)
Listingnya ditempatkan pada tombol "kosong"
Selamat Mencoba..!
Mas untuk penrintah ini tu maksudnya pah yach....
BalasHapusnotrans.ttransnotrans.value;
silahkan liat di catatan (NB) bagian bawah
Hapusoh ya mas notrans := copy (faktur 3,3) ; //002
BalasHapusfaktur yang gimna maksudnya...
itu script utk penomoran otomatis pd transaksi yg kedua, jadi menggunakan fungsi copy pd 3 karakter terakhir pd no. faktur
Hapus